Puzzle 1

M, N, O, P, Q, R, and S are seven people living on seven different floors of a building but not necessarily in the same order. The lowermost floor of the building is numbered 1, the one above that is numbered 2 and so on till the topmost floor is numbered 7. Each one of them have different income i.e. 3500, 15000, 7500, 9000, 11000, 13500 and 5000. (But not necessarily in the same order.)

M lives on an odd numbered floor but not on the floor numbered 3. The one who has income of 11000 lives immediately above M. Only two people live between M and the one who has income of 7500. The one who has income 15000 lives on one of the odd numbered floors above P. P lives on odd numbered floor. Only three people live between O and the one who has income of 15000. The one, whose income is 7500 lives immediately above O. The one, who has income of 3500 lives immediately above the one, who has income of 5000. S lives on an odd numbered floor but not on 3rd floor. Only one person lives between N and Q. N lives on one of the floors above Q. Neither O nor M has income of 9000. Q does not has income of 7500.

Puzzle 2

Eight persons P,Q,R,S,T,U,V and W live on eight different floors of a building. The ground floor is numbered one and the topmost is numbered eight. Each of them likes a different games i.e. Cricket, Hockey, Table Tennis, Rugby, Chess ,Badminton, Football and Kabaddi.

Only one person lives between R and the one who likes Cricket. P lives
immediately above U, who lives on an odd numbered floor. The one who likes Football lives on an even numbered floor but not on floor no. 8. Only two persons live between U and the one who likes Football. Only one person lives between U and the one who likes Chess. Neither R nor T lives on floor numbered 1. Only two persons live between P and T. the one who likes chess does not live on floor numbered 1st . Q lives on an even numbered floor and immediately above R. The one who likes Kabaddi lives on an even numbered floor and lives immediately above the person who likes Rugby. W lives just below the one who likes Rugby. R does not like Chess or Rugby. Only two person live between the one who likes Badminton and the one who likes Hockey. The one who likes Badminton does not live on an odd numbered floor. S does not live on an odd numbered floor.

Puzzle 3

Six People – A, C, D, E, F, and G live in eight different floors of building (but not necessarily in the same order). Two of the floors in the building are vacant. The lowermost floor of the building is numbered one, the one above that is numbered two, and so on till the topmost floor is numbered eight. Each one of them likes a different brands of shoes, namely Adidas, Liberty, Puma, Bata, Nivea and NIKE (but not necessarily in the same order). All have a different number of books 2, 3, 4, 5, 6 and 8 but not in same order.

The difference of books of C and G is equal to the number of books hold by F. The number of floors above F is same as the number of floors between F and D. F lives an odd numbered floor above the floor numbered four. There are three people live between the two vacant floors. Only three floors between D and the one who likes Bata. The one who likes Nivea lives immediately above G. The difference of books of D and A is equal to the number of books hold by E. Only three floors between G and A.The one who likes NIKE lives immediately above the one who likes Adidas. C has more books than G. C lives immediately above the one who likes Puma. D has more books than A. The number of floors between F and the one who likes LIBERTY is only one. The one who likes LIBERTYShoes immediately below one of the vacant floors. The floor number of the vacant floors are even – number. Only two floors are there between the one who likes NIKE and Bata. C lived immediately below one of the vacant floors and not on the ground floor. C neither lived on floor number 5 nor floor number 3. A has more than 3 books. The one who likes Liberty lives on one of the floors below the floor number 4. G does not have 4 books. A has neither 2 nor 6 books. The number of books hold by C, G and F together is “4” less than the number of books hold by E, A and D together.

Puzzle 4

In a 8- storey building, ground floor being numbered 1, next floor being numbered 2 and so on , there lives 8 persons- A, B, C, D, E, F, G and H along with their wives – P, Q, R, S, T, U, V and W. They have different cars- Alto, Breeza, Desire, Ferrari, Mercedes, Santro, Scorpio, and Zen not necessarily in the same order. Each couple has a unique car.

H lives with his wife, P on an even numbered floor but not on the top most floor. H does not have Santro. The one having Alto lives immediately below the one in which W lives. The one who has Breeza lives on an odd numbered floor. U has Scorpio. D lives on an odd numbered floor. B does not live on floor numbered 1. The one who has Ferrari lives on one of the floors below the one who has Santro. D is not married to U. T is wife of neither B nor E. F lives on an odd numbered floor but above floor number 3. Only one person lives between H and G. The one who has Breeza lives immediately above the one who has Ferrari. D’s wife is not among T, Q and S. Q is not married to E. T has Breeza car. Three person live between F and E,who has Desire car. R has Mercedes. C is married to W and he lives immediately above B who lives on an odd numbered floor. B and F are not neighbourers to each other (can not live immediately above or below each other). More than 3 persons live between B and one having Mercedes. The one having Mercedes does not live on floor numbered 2. F and the one who has Mercedes does not live on floor numbered 7. C does not live on the top most floor. T lives 2 floors below D.

Puzzle 5

7 persons – A, B, C, D, E, F and G live on 7 different floors in such a way that lowermost floor is numbered 1 and topmost floor is numbered 7. They are born in different months – January, March, April, June, July, August, September but not necessarily in the same order. Person born in a month having odd number of days lives on odd numbered floor while person born in a month having even number of days lives on even numbered floor.

A was born in July. E is an immediate neighbor of person who was born in August. The one who lives on floor numbered 6 was not born in June. D was born in a month having less than 31 days. Only 2 persons live between C and the one born in July. Equal number of floors are there between the floors on which person born in January and March lives as there are months in January and March according to calendar. There is only 1 floor between F and G, who was born before F. C was born neither in April nor in June. D was born after April. F was born neither in August nor in January. Equal number of persons live between A and C as that in C and person born in August. B was born neither in March nor in August.
